How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Union City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Union City Studio Apartments | $1,195 | $900 | $1,419 |
| Union City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,442 | $673 | $3,596 |
| Union City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,635 | $898 | $2,978 |
| Union City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,112 | $889 | $4,724 |
| Union City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,686 | $2,026 | $4,256 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Union City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$1,625 | $1,175 | $2,250 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$2,033 | $1,445 | $3,500 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$2,536 | $1,665 | $6,000 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$2,767 | $1,945 | $3,500 |
| 6 Bedroom Homes | $5,292 | $2,085 | $8,500 |
